Benson vs. Blackmon vs. Darnell
Interesting debate at this point. Blackmon and Darnell are pretty similar offensively, Benson and Blackmon defensively. I have them ranked Darnell, Blackmon, Benson. I worry about Benson’s k-rate and contact rate, so even with his defense, I have to rank him below the other two. Blackmon has the defensive edge on Darnell, even if they both end up in LF, but I feel like Darnell’s bat will translate to the majors better, especially with his batting eye.
